引言:围绕TP钱包的货币单位设计,本文以技术指南视角,从跨链通信、智能合约实现、安全巡检、全球化创新与智能化平台五个维度,提出可操作的流程与建议。
一、单位模型与跨链通信流程
1) 统一单位层(Unit Layer):在钱包端定义最小计量单位(如wei类最小单位)并维护单位元数据库(精度、小数位、符号、链ID)。

2https://www.shxcjhb.com ,) 跨链映射流程:发起链A的单位转换请求→使用桥协议(消息格式统一、包含来源单位ID、目标链ID、token哈希)→跨链适配器(校验小数、执行缩放倍数/溢出检查)→目标链生成映射或锚定代币。
3) 精度策略:采用可插拔精度转换表与舍入策略,保留原始最小单位证明以便回溯与争议解决。

二、智能合约技术实践
1) 单位抽象合约:提供toBaseUnit/fromBaseUnit函数、精度元数据、事件日志,便于前端与链上一致性校验。
2) 可升级性:采用代理模式与治理开关,允许在发现进制错误或拓展新链时无缝升级单位映射逻辑。
3) 互操作接口:实现标准化ABI,支持跨链网关、预言机与桥合约的调用与校验。
三、安全巡检与审计流程
1) 静态与形式化验证:对单位转换函数、缩放与舍入逻辑进行符号执行与边界条件证明。
2) 动态监控:埋点单位异常(精度溢出、未对齐转换)并触发回滚或暂停桥操作。
3) 工程化审计流程:CI触发单元测试(多链样本)、第三方安全审计、蓝绿部署与回滚方案。
四、全球化与智能化平台支持
1) 多语言与本地化:单位元数据支持国际化名词与货币显示策略(法币汇率联动)。
2) 智能合规与风控:结合链上行为分析与KYC/AML策略,自动识别异常单位流转并标注风险等级。
3) 智能化平台运营:运用机器学习预测单位映射冲突、自动建议最优舍入策略并生成审计报告。
结语:将货币单位视为分层可编程资产,可通过统一元数据、标准化合约接口、安全巡检与智能化运维,构建一个兼顾跨链互操作性与全球合规性的TP钱包货币单位体系。
评论
alice92
很实用的技术路线图,单位抽象合约值得复用。
区块链小王
建议补充多币种法币汇率更新频率的实现细节。
Dev_赵
形式化验证部分能否给出工具链建议?很期待。
CryptoLuna
智能化风控思路清晰,建议加上异常回滚示例。
安全审计师
审计与CI流程描述到位,适合工程化落地。